编写物理模拟应用

Tds*_*Tds 2 javascript physics

我是计算机编程的新手,并且有一些使用python编程的经验.我正在考虑开发一个程序来进行物理模拟(射弹,圆周运动,阻尼简谐运动系统等)作为业余爱好项目.我想编写一个程序,它可以由一个非技术用户(我的同学)在各种平台(mac,windows等)上运行,没有任何设置和python似乎不是一个很好的选择建立这样一个程序所以我正在寻找替代方案.JavaScript引起了我的注意,因为它似乎在现代浏览器上非常强大,特别是与HTML5结合使用.我想知道是否适合在这种类型的应用程序中使用JavaScript,以及关于我应该从哪里开始的一些信息(我没有JavaScript知识)在此先感谢!

是的,我确实看过网站上的类似线程,但我想自己写一些东西比使用第三方库(除了前端,如果可能的话):)

Kos*_*Kos 6

实际上你的问题是什么?:)

你能用Python写一个物理模拟吗?
当然是.

你能用Javascript写一个物理模拟吗?
对.

它会有用吗?
应该是.

会有效吗?
当然,效率不如C实现.但对于小规模的模拟,你应该拥有足够的功能与当前的JIT JavaScript解释器.我想,30fps的数十或数百个物体看起来像一个安全的近似值.

在JS中编写物理模拟时,你能使用现代HTML吗?
模拟和显示是两个不同的东西,但是,如果你想为你的模拟制作一个图形前端,HTML和CSS的现代功能肯定是有用的.但是如果你用其他任何语言编写它,你仍然可以选择可视化.

如何学习JavaScript?
网上有很多教程,但我不知道有什么特别值得推荐的; 也许其他人可以在这里填写我.